Handover: export retries (Corvid Reports)

Taking two weeks off; here's the state. Failed PDF exports now go to a retry queue instead of being dropped. Backoff is exponential, capped at six attempts, then dead-lettered. Don't bump the cap without checking queue depth first — Maren's dashboard shows it. Retry worker reads its settings at boot only. The settings it runs with are these.

config for kafof-bawef:
holath:
  log_level: debug
  metrics_host: metrics.holath.qorvelsys.internal
  pin: 2191
  pool_size: 32

**Mgmt Meeting Minutes — Retiring the Brightline Range**

Quick recap for sales leads at Fenholt Supplies: we agreed to retire the Brightline fixture range by year-end. Remaining stock moves to clearance pricing next month, and accounts on standing orders get migrated to the Lumetta range. Trade-in incentives were approved in principle. The confidential note on next steps sits just below.

board note of bajof-bajeg: The pricing group signed off on a budget of $13.4 million for Project Sildor. The renewal with Lamixek Holdings closes at $48.9 million a year, 49 percent above the last contract.

Memo — Sales Leads Only

Team, quick update on the Arbelline term sheet. Their partnership offer landed Tuesday: co-selling rights in the northern region, shared pipeline reporting, and a revenue split that's better than we expected. Legal flags two clauses on exclusivity that need softening before we sign anything. Please hold off on mentioning Arbelline in any customer conversations until this closes — seriously, not a word. Targeting a decision by the 20th. The confidential note below explains how this fits our plans.

internal memo for yahag-tahog: The pricing group signed off on a budget of $152.8 million for Project Soriel.

**Large Deal Discounts — Managers Only**

Quick refresher for finance folks: any Quellant deal above 250 seats can go to 18% off list without extra sign-off. Beyond that, loop in Priya from deal desk — she's fast, promise. Stacking promo codes on top is a no-go, and multi-year terms cap at 25% total. Log everything in the Marlowe tracker so quarter-end doesn't become a scavenger hunt. One more thing before you dive in.

internal memo for hafog-hadug: The pricing group signed off on a budget of $16.1 million for Project Gorir. The renewal with Oliionax Systems closes at $14.1 million a year, 46 percent above the last contract.